Transaction fed619b7663633272a3b36d3cf67899e9ee856fac45548eb00579414e7aecfb0

66 Input
2 Outputs
  • fed619b7663633272a3b36d3cf67899e9ee856fac45548eb00579414e7aecfb0:0
  • value  500000000
    address  1KSuWHN6Hc36tJmYtk4RyAbkKDtNjACRX9
  • fed619b7663633272a3b36d3cf67899e9ee856fac45548eb00579414e7aecfb0:1
  • value  980276
    address  19fCVucmqzwVwg2DH1KxjMmwg3rhrger19